Molly adjusted her oversized sunglasses and leaned across the wobbly diner booth. “Okay, Bill, listen. We hit the party at exactly three-fifteen, right when they’re singing Happy Birthday. Nobody’s watching the gift table during that off-key massacre.” Bill slurped his coffee and grinned like a man who’d already spent the loot. “You’re a genius, Mol. Pure evil wrapped in sparkly logic. But how do we blend in? We look like we rob banks for a living.” “We look like we rob banks because we do rob banks, you walnut. That’s why I bought the props.” Molly slid a plastic bag across the table. “You’re going as the world’s saddest clown. I’m the balloon artist. Kids won’t suspect a thing.” Bill peeked inside and recoiled. “A clown? With the red nose and everything? I’ll have nightmares about myself.” “Better than the alternative. Last time you tried blending in you wore that fake mustache and the birthday mom thought you were her ex-husband. We barely escaped with the cake.” “Fair point,” Bill muttered. “Fine, clown it is. What’s the exit strategy? Those ankle-biters are fast when sugar’s involved.” Molly tapped a crude map drawn on a napkin. “Back door by the bounce house. I deflate it while you load the presents into the fake ambulance we’re borrowing. Parents see a clown and a paramedic carrying boxes, they assume it’s part of the show. We’re basically performance artists with larceny credentials.” Bill chuckled. “You’re enjoying this way too much. We’re stealing teddy bears and junior chemistry sets, not diamonds.” “Sentimental value, Bill. Those presents are worth their weight in parental guilt. Plus little Timmy’s getting a PlayStation 5. I saw the box. We can flip that in twenty minutes flat.” “Timmy’s gonna cry,” Bill said, almost sounding sorry. “Timmy cries when the juice box is warm. He’ll survive. We’ll leave him a balloon animal as restitution. Maybe a sad little giraffe to match his emotional state.” Bill leaned back, arms crossed. “You’ve thought of everything except the dog. There’s always a dog at these things, Mol. Some yappy little monster that sniffs out guilt like it’s bacon.” Molly waved a dismissive hand. “I’ve got bacon-flavored tranquilizer treats. Non-harmful, just makes him dopey and friendly. He’ll think we’re his new best friends.” “You’re terrifying when you’re organized.” “Thank you. Now, important question: do we take the piñata too? There’s candy in there and I’ve got a sweet tooth.” Bill stared at her. “We’re not animals, Molly. The piñata stays. We have standards.” “Since when?” “Since never, but I’m drawing the line at destroying a paper donkey in front of thirty screaming children. My conscience has limits.” Molly sighed theatrically. “Fine. Piñata lives. But the presents are ours. We hit hard, we hit fast, and we leave with enough loot to finally buy that taco truck we’ve been talking about.” Bill raised his coffee mug in a toast. “To robbing children and achieving our dreams.” Molly clinked her mug against his. “And to never speaking of this job again after today.” “Deal,” Bill said, already laughing. “Let’s go make some memories they’ll need therapy for.”
